I've had some 3.5's since 1989 and still listen to them, although I do have some B&W's and and have had friends Martin Logan's for about 6 months. I switch speakers in the system when I feel like it. I've driven the Thiels with Adcom (200 pwc), Krell (100 wpc), now I'm using a Krell 2250 (250 wpc). They do respond better to more power. I think one the best investments I've made is a tubed VTL 5.5 pre which replaced a Krell KSL pre. I would recommend finding a decent tubed pre and there are a few good ones that are resonably priced - maybe a VTL 2.5. I'd pair it with a good solid state with decent current - maybe 150 wpc. As always, you're much better off if you can listen in your home.
